How Splenda Ingredients Actually Work
At its core, Splenda is a brand of sucralose, a synthetic sweetener created by modifying sugar molecules. This modification process involves replacing three hydrogen-oxygen groups in the sugar molecule with chlorine atoms, resulting in a compound that is 600 times sweeter than sugar. When we consume sucralose, it doesn't break down in our bodies like sugar does; instead, it passes through our system untouched, providing a calorie-free sweetness experience.

Is Splenda Ingredients Safe?
Studies have consistently shown that sucralose, the primary ingredient in Splenda, is non-toxic and doesn't pose a risk to human health. However, some individuals may experience digestive issues, such as bloating or gas, due to the artificial sweetener's ability to slow down digestion.
Can I Use Splenda Ingredients While Pregnant or Breastfeeding?
While there's limited research on the use of Splenda ingredients during pregnancy and breastfeeding, it's generally recommended to err on the side of caution. As a precautionary measure, consider consulting a healthcare professional before consuming Splenda or any other artificial sweetener.

Opportunities and Considerations
While Splenda ingredients offer a convenient, calorie-free sweetness option, it's essential to be aware of their limitations and potential drawbacks. For instance, some people may be sensitive to sucralose, and consuming high amounts can lead to digestive issues. Additionally, relying on artificial sweeteners might obscure the underlying issue of our sugar cravings, which is a complex combination of emotional, environmental, and physiological factors.
Things People Often Misunderstand
One common myth surrounding Splenda ingredients is that they're completely calorie-free. While sucralose doesn't contribute to calorie intake, some products containing Splenda may have additional ingredients that could affect calorie counts.
